Both systems run on DC power from a driver or power supply. The operating voltage affects how efficiently current flows through the strip and how well it performs over longer distances. The difference is practical and significant.
Why 24V Is Better for Most Applications
Longer run lengths: At the same wattage, a 24V strip can run approximately twice as far as a 12V strip before visible voltage drop occurs.
More driver options: The 24V driver market is larger and better served at all wattages and price points.
Lower current for the same output: Lower current means less heat in the wiring, better efficiency, and longer component life.
Professional standard: Commercial, architectural, and trade installations have standardised on 24V. A 24V ecosystem gives better long-term compatibility.
When 12V Makes Sense
Very short runs, leisure and automotive applications (caravans, boats, campervans where 12V is the native DC supply), and some specialist products. For standard residential and commercial LED strip installations, 24V is the correct choice.
